Winterizing 

This is the time of year to consider winterizing your property.  Will you be visiting the lake in the winter months?  Will you be able to check on your home if we receive one of those overnight freeze events? 

What about your HVAC equipment?  Have you changed the filters in your units in a while?  Industry standards recommend changing filters every month!  

Winter (October - February for us) is also the time of year to take care of projects that you want to have ready by the Memorial Day Weekend Party.  What ideas do you have - Can we help you with those?

Our Family

Groves Mechanical is a family business and has been since we began.  Granny & Pap managed our company in Wichita Falls and then moved to Possum Kingdom Lake and their son - Kirby became an integral part of Groves.  As the years went on Kirby's wife joined the management team and used her expertise for bookkeeping, payroll, and accounting to help her husband and father-in-law.   

Granny & Pap retired in the mid 1980s, Kirby & Kathy retired in 2002, and their sons Kevin & Kerry became managing partners of our company.  Historically everyone in the family has worked for the company.  Even in the 70s and 80s Pap's son-in-laws worked for Groves so it was only natural that Kevin & Kerry's boys would have that rite of passage too!
